The Forty Foot Drain in Cambridgeshire is an artificial drainage river in Cambridgeshire. It is also known as Vermuyden’s Drain
Located in the Fens, in a relatively flat and exposed part of the country, it is only 10 miles long.
Stretching between Wells Bridge, where it joins the River Nene, and Welches Dam Sluice, where it joins the Counter Wash Drain, the drain then becomes the Old Bedford River.
